What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.
Weekly family incomes in Betley are far below the Victorian average, with a gap of $1,187. This small area sees much lower earnings than most similar places, with typical household income sitting at just $780 per week.
All suburb / locality areas, 2021. The marker is Betley — lower than 95% of areas.
Median personal, family and household incomes.
Typical weekly personal income is $419, which is far below the national figure of $805. Both family and household incomes are also among the lowest for areas of this size.

High earners and the full distribution.
No households in Betley earn $3,000 or more a week, a figure far below the 22.7% seen across Victoria. Most people earn under $650 weekly, while 0% of residents earn $2,000 or more per week.
